  • Patent number: 11066452
    Abstract: The present embodiments relate to antibody binding nanofibrils obtainable by co-fibrillation of carrier proteins and carrier-Z fusion proteins at a molar ratio selected within an interval of from 1:0.20 to 1:0.90. The antibody binding nanofibrils have extremely high antibody binding capacity and can thereby be used in various applications, such as antibody purification, and detection of biomarkers in point of care or laboratory diagnosis applications.   • Patent number: 9938551
    Abstract: Disclosed are a number of homologs and variants of Hypocrea jecorina Ce17A (formerly Trichoderma reesei cellobiohydrolase I or CBH1), nucleic acids encoding the same and methods for producing the same. The homologs and variant cellulases have the amino acid sequence of a glycosyl hydrolase of family 7A wherein one or more amino acid residues are substituted and/or deleted.

  • Publication number: 20180002683
    Abstract: Provided are certain glycosyl hydrolase family 3 (GH3) beta-xylosidases engineered to acquire beta-glucosidase activities. Provided also are compositions comprising such multi-functional GH3 enzymes and methods of use or industrial applications thereof.
